### Runbook — PoolHopper connection pool bump

Quick one for the sync: we're raising the Verdigris DB pool ceiling from 40 to 64 per node. Roll one node at a time and watch for saturation alarms — if wait times climb, back off. The pooler binary ships as a signed artifact, so rebuilds need re-signing before deploy. Use the current deploy key:

deploy key for yajop-fahop: bky3_h1v

Break-glass access — Hollowcache bloom layer. Plugin authors: the bloom filter in front of the Strandstore key-value tier normally cannot be bypassed. In a confirmed false-positive storm, operators may disable it via the break-glass console; all bypasses are logged and reviewed. Plugins must tolerate a brief latency spike during bypass. The break-glass console accepts the recovery passphrase given below.

recovery phrase for bawep-kawef: oliath-casdor

**Runbook: Dustpan retention sweeper — weekly sync notes**

The Dustpan sweeper purges expired records from the Lorvane analytics store each night between 01:00 and 03:00 local. It honors per-tenant retention overrides stored in `retention_policies`, so always check that table before assuming a deletion was erroneous. If the sweeper exits nonzero, do not rerun it blindly; inspect the last committed batch marker to avoid double-deletes. For manual inspection of the batch markers, connect to the policy database with the string below.

replica DSN, kajep-yahag: mssql://praok_svc:iF@db-8d68.plorvaio.local:5432/eliion